RHINELANDER – A replica of the Vietnam Veterans Memorial expected to draw veterans and school groups to Rhinelander this weekend.  The Wall is a three-quarter scale replica of the Vietnam Veterans Memorial and gives people the opportunity to see the names of the 58,000 American service members who died in the Vietnam War. LANSING, Mich. (AP) — Michigan Gov. Gretchen Whitmer signed legislation Wednesday that will prohibit companies from firing or otherwise retaliating against workers for receiving an abortion. N. WISCONSIN – The fire Danger remains VERY HIGH in Iron, Ashland, Bayfield Counties and much of Northern Wisconsin.  Burning is highly discouraged.   Rain moves in later today. 

UPPER MICHIGAN – Off Road Vehicle Season Beginning In Michigan, DNR Advises Caution. The Michigan Department of Natural Resources reminds residents that with warmer weather, Off Road Vehicle Season has begun in the U.P., and with many trails already open, the DNR is recommending exercising caution. ASHLAND COUNTY – A court hearing is scheduled for this week as environmental and tribal advocates continue to voice concerns about an oil and gas pipeline that runs across northern Wisconsin. BARAGA – The Baraga County man arrested Thursday, May 11 after a year-long Upper Peninsula Substance Enforcement Team investigation faces six felony charges in Baraga County District Court. 41-year-old Randy Owens was arraigned in Baraga County District Court Monday.
